My fellow Americans need to learn about the Battle of Blair Mountain and the rest of the bloody history of the labor movement. There is a long history of political violence in this country.

Skylight is a TikTok wannabe app being developed that will use the same AT protocol as Bluesky. However, it's, at best, 6 months away from being available on any platform and will probably only be available on Apple or Android at launch. More time before all phone users can use it.
